TrofoPlanGreek Organic Mountain Tea Sideritis is a premium, hand-picked, and naturally air-dried herbal tea from Greece, made exclusively from leaves and flowers. This caffeine-free, aromatic tea offers a strong, authentic taste and versatile use, packaged in a convenient 120g resealable doypack.

A bulky herbal tea that taste surprisingly good.
As someone who drinks a lot of different teas and infusions I was excited to try this Mountain Tea (also called Ironwort) as it comes with a huge amount of health benefits. It’s been used as a herbal medicine for thousands of years to help boost the immune system, fight colds and flu like systems and to help with anxiety, just to name a few. It’s also an excellent source of iron, vitamin C and antioxidants.This Mountain Tea comes in a large plastic bag and is cut up into large pieces, with full flowers and leaves in it. On opening the bag I was hit by the strong floral/herb like smell which was pretty pleasant. There were no directions on how to brew this so I winged it a little.Because the pieces are so big I opted to use a tea maker/infusion pot as I didn’t think it would work well in my normal metal infuser. It would work well in a normal tea pot and then being poured through a strainer as well. I let it sit for a couple minutes and tried it but it was still very weak so I left it for around another 10 minutes to steep in the water.On tasting it I was really surprised at how nice it tasted. It’s somewhere between peppermint and chamomile but a little sweeter than both. It’s something that you could probably add a little sugar too or even honey if you have a sweet tooth. It was really easy to drink and an enjoyable cup tea.Overall I’m really happy with the way this tea comes and with how it tastes, and if you enjoy herbal teas (and the benefits that come with them) I’d definitely recommend it.
